Young Rebel Set
The Young Rebel Set are a rock band from the North East English town of Stockford-on-Tees. Formed in 2007 around the songs of singer/songwriter Matthew Chipchase, the band quickly gained traction for their gritty, honest sound, which took inspiration from American icons like Bruce Springsteen and Johnny Cash, '90s Brit-pop, and socially conscious bands like the Clash and the Pogues. They spent their first few years steadily releasing singles and touring the U.K. and Europe, where they found unexpected success in Germany. In 2011, they signed with British label Ignition Records (Oasis, Primal Scream), who issued the band's debut album Curse Our Love. More widespread touring followed the release and in 2013 they set up camp in Glasgow at producer Paul Savage's (Mogwai, Franz Ferdinand) Chem19 Studios to record their follow-up album. Released in September 2014, Crocodile deepened the band's personal, earthy aesthetic with a more cohesive, full-band approach.
